Transaction 69aa577049f725de9910c7bf0166c1e072809194b069892f2379595b88b41a1d
1 Input
1 Output
-
69aa577049f725de9910c7bf0166c1e072809194b069892f2379595b88b41a1d:0
- value
- 313667
- script pubkey
- OP_0 OP_PUSHBYTES_20 663bdff519ef2b436c076b4dc30f390dfe93f956
- address
- bc1qvcaalageau45xmq8ddxuxreephlf872k8jt6ce